Output 7f68666680e3aa6308d9152d5c29a5cbabdc55dbbf65d09d9016d90412f9a272:5

value
644724752
script pubkey
OP_0 OP_PUSHBYTES_20 c311c4f7d1e88c7b0f7903e690737985b6412026
address
bc1qcvgufa73azx8krmeq0nfqumeskmyzgpxnphl9s
transaction
7f68666680e3aa6308d9152d5c29a5cbabdc55dbbf65d09d9016d90412f9a272
spent
true